On the 25th July I had medical management for a missed miscarriage when I thought I was 9.5 weeks (6 week sac on scan). After getting a few very faint positive pregnancy tests I called my EPAU. I've had a scan today and they have seen 'vascular' looking tissue in my uterus which they think could be molar. I'm booked in for surgery tomo AM and they have said 3-5 weeks for results as to whether the tissue was molar or not.

I'm incredibly nervous and wanted to see if anyone else was going through the same thing or has been through it!

OP posts:
aeastley93 · 22/08/2019 20:50

In case anyone reads this read.. I'm home again now after the surgery and general anesthetic. Had an ERPC. Have to test again in two weeks for negative test. Should have my results to see if the pregnancy was molar in two weeks or so as well. Dr said provided that's clear and pregnancy test negative, I can try again when I'm ready.
